Lines Matching refs:container

34     auto container = windowRoot_->GetOrCreateWindowNodeContainer(node->GetDisplayId());  in NotifyAccessibilityWindowInfo()  local
35 if (container == nullptr) { in NotifyAccessibilityWindowInfo()
41 UpdateFocusChangeEvent(container); in NotifyAccessibilityWindowInfo()
42 NotifyAccessibilityWindowInfo(nodes, container->GetFocusWindow(), type); in NotifyAccessibilityWindowInfo()
52 auto container = windowRoot_->GetOrCreateWindowNodeContainer(displayId); in NotifyAccessibilityWindowInfo() local
53 if (container == nullptr) { in NotifyAccessibilityWindowInfo()
57 UpdateFocusChangeEvent(container); in NotifyAccessibilityWindowInfo()
58 NotifyAccessibilityWindowInfo(nodes, container->GetFocusWindow(), type); in NotifyAccessibilityWindowInfo()
63 auto container = windowRoot_->GetOrCreateWindowNodeContainer(displayId); in NotifyAccessibilityWindowInfo() local
64 if (container == nullptr) { in NotifyAccessibilityWindowInfo()
69 container->TraverseContainer(nodes); in NotifyAccessibilityWindowInfo()
70 UpdateFocusChangeEvent(container); in NotifyAccessibilityWindowInfo()
71 NotifyAccessibilityWindowInfo(nodes, container->GetFocusWindow(), type); in NotifyAccessibilityWindowInfo()
120 auto container = windowRoot_->GetOrCreateWindowNodeContainer(displayId); in GetAccessibilityWindowInfo() local
121 if (windowNodeContainers.count(screenGroupId) == 0 && container != nullptr) { in GetAccessibilityWindowInfo()
122 windowNodeContainers.insert(std::make_pair(screenGroupId, container)); in GetAccessibilityWindowInfo()
124 container->TraverseContainer(nodes); in GetAccessibilityWindowInfo()
125 FillAccessibilityWindowInfo(nodes, container->GetFocusWindow(), infos); in GetAccessibilityWindowInfo()
130 void AccessibilityConnection::UpdateFocusChangeEvent(const sptr<WindowNodeContainer>& container) in UpdateFocusChangeEvent() argument
132 if (container == nullptr) { in UpdateFocusChangeEvent()
137 uint32_t focusWindowId = container->GetFocusWindow(); in UpdateFocusChangeEvent()
138 auto iter = focusedWindowMap_.find(container); in UpdateFocusChangeEvent()
140 focusedWindowMap_.insert(std::make_pair(container, focusWindowId)); in UpdateFocusChangeEvent()